
C.M. Harris is an award-winning children’s author and publisher who turned adversity into opportunity after facing employment discrimination due to her disability, diagnosed with Charcot-Marie Tooth Disease at age 7 and "The Suicide Disease" at age 25.. She founded Purple Diamond Press to create meaningful stories that inspire kindness, inclusion, and perseverance. She proves that challenges can be rewritten into success, from struggling to find a job to having her bestselling book recognized by ABC7 News, the BBC, and the San Francisco 49ers.
